In 1992, a Texas small business owner tried syndicating weekly political cartoons to BBSes.
His "telecomics," as he called them, are an overlooked early experiment in online comics, at a key moment in U.S. politics.

New data obtained by @stltoday indicates hundreds of the buildings mangled by the May 16 tornado in St. Louis were likely vacant before the storm even hit.
That could hobble the city's efforts to rebuild the neighborhoods hit hardest by the storm.
